krzyzanowskim / Natalie

Natalie - Storyboard Code Generator (for Swift)
http://blog.krzyzanowskim.com/2015/04/15/natalie-storyboard-code-generator/
MIT License
1.17k stars 74 forks source link

performSegue should accept sender of type Any? #92

Closed aspyre closed 7 years ago

aspyre commented 7 years ago

func perform<T: SegueProtocol>(segue: T, sender: AnyObject?) { if let identifier = segue.identifier { performSegue(withIdentifier: identifier, sender: sender) } }

The above method accepts AnyObject as the sender parameter, but the framework performSegue method has Any as the sender type.